Co jsou atributy?
Pohled na atribut funguje jako dimenze. Spojuje více stolů a funguje jako Master. Zobrazení atributů je opakovaně použitelné objekty.
Zobrazení atributů má následující výhodu -
- Zobrazení atributů funguje jako kontext hlavních dat, který poskytuje text nebo popis pro pole Klíč / Neklíč.
- Zobrazení atributů lze znovu použít v analytickém zobrazení a zobrazení výpočtu.
- Zobrazení atributů se používá k výběru podmnožiny sloupců a řádků z databázové tabulky.
- Atributy (pole) lze vypočítat z více polí tabulky.
- Neexistuje žádná možnost měření a agregace.
Typ zobrazení atributu
Zobrazení atributů jsou 3 typy-
Typ zobrazení atributu> | Popis |
Standard | Jedná se o standardní atribut, který je vytvářen poli tabulky. |
Čas | Jedná se o zobrazení atributu Čas, které je založeno na výchozím časovém rozvrhu - Pro typ kalendáře gregoriánský -
|
Odvozený | Jedná se o pohled atributů, který je odvozen z jiného existujícího pohledu atributů. Zobrazení odvozených atributů se otevře v režimu jen pro čtení. Jediným upravitelným polem je jeho popis. Kopírovat z - Chcete-li definovat zobrazení atributu, zkopírováním existujícího pohledu atributu můžete použít možnost „Kopírovat z“. |
Poznámka: Rozdíl mezi Derived a Copy from je, v případě odvozeného, můžete upravit pouze popis nového pohledu atributů, zatímco v případě copy můžete upravit úplně vše.
Vytvořte standardní zobrazení atributů
Vytvoření standardního pohledu má předdefinovaný krok níže -
Vytvoření tabulky pro zobrazení atributu
Zde vytvoříme standardní zobrazení atributů pro tabulku produktů, takže nejprve vytvoříme tabulku „PRODUCT“ a „PRODUCT_DESC“.
SQL Script je pro vytvoření tabulky zobrazen níže -
Tabulka produktů Script -
VYTVOŘIT TABULKU SLOUPKU „DHK_SCHEMA“. „PRODUKT“(„PRODUCT_ID“ NVARCHAR (10) PRIMÁRNÍ KLÍČ,„SUPPLIER_ID“ NVARCHAR (10),"KATEGORIE" NVARCHAR (3),„CENA“ DECIMÁLNÍ (5,2));VLOŽTE DO „DHK_SCHEMA“. „HODNOTY“ PRODUKTU („A0001“, „10 000“, „A“, 500,00);VLOŽTE DO „DHK_SCHEMA“. „HODNOTY“ PRODUKTU („A0002“, „10 000“, „B“, 300,00);VLOŽTE DO „DHK_SCHEMA“. „HODNOTY“ PRODUKTU („A0003“, „10 000“, „C“, 200,00);VLOŽTE DO „DHK_SCHEMA“. „HODNOTY“ PRODUKTU („A0004“, „10 000“, „D“, 100,00);VLOŽTE DO „DHK_SCHEMA“. „HODNOTY“ PRODUKTU („A0005“, „10 000“, „A“, 550,00);
Tabulka popisu produktu Script-
VYTVOŘIT TABULKU SLOUPKU „DHK_SCHEMA“. „PRODUCT_DESC“(„PRODUCT_ID“ NVARCHAR (10) PRIMÁRNÍ KLÍČ,„PRODUCT_NAME“ NVARCHAR (10));INSERT INTO "DHK_SCHEMA". "PRODUCT_DESC" VALUES ('A0001', 'PRODUCT1');INSERT INTO "DHK_SCHEMA". "PRODUCT_DESC" VALUES ('A0002', 'PRODUCT2');INSERT INTO "DHK_SCHEMA". "PRODUCT_DESC" VALUES ('A0003', 'PRODUCT3');INSERT INTO "DHK_SCHEMA". "PRODUCT_DESC" VALUES ('A0004', 'PRODUCT4');INSERT INTO "DHK_SCHEMA". "PRODUCT_DESC" VALUES ('A0005', 'PRODUCT5');
Nyní jsou ve schématu „DHK_SCHEMA“ vytvořeny tabulky „PRODUCT“ a „PRODUCT_DESC“.
Vytvoření pohledu atributů
KROK 1) v tomto kroku,
- Vyberte systém SAP HANA.
- Vyberte složku obsahu.
- Vyberte Nestrukturální modelování balíčků v části Balíček DHK_SCHEMA v uzlu obsahu a klikněte pravým tlačítkem-> nový.
- Vyberte možnost zobrazení atributu.
KROK 2) Nyní v dalším okně,
- Zadejte název atributu a štítek.
- Vyberte typ zobrazení, zde Zobrazení atributů.
- Vyberte podtyp jako „Standardní“.
- Klikněte na tlačítko Dokončit.
KROK 3) Otevře se obrazovka editoru zobrazení informací. Podrobnosti o jednotlivých částech v editoru informací jsou uvedeny níže -
- Podokno scénáře : V tomto podokně existuje následující uzel -
- Sémantika
- Datový základ
- Podokno podrobností : V tomto podokně existuje následující karta -
- Sloupec
- Zobrazit vlastnosti
- Hierchery
- Sémantika (podokno scénáře): Tento uzel představuje výstupní strukturu pohledu. Tady je Dimenze.
- Data Foundation (podokno scénáře): Tento uzel představuje tabulku, kterou používáme pro definování pohledu atributů.
- Zde přetáhneme tabulku pro vytvoření pohledu atributů.
- Zobrazí se karta (sloupce, Vlastnosti zobrazení, Hierarchie) pro podokno podrobností.
- Místní : Zde se zobrazí všechny podrobnosti o místních atributech.
- Zobrazit: Filtr pro místní atribut.
- Detail atributu.
- Toto je panel nástrojů pro analýzu výkonu, sloupec Najít, ověření, aktivaci, náhled dat atd.
KROK 4) Chcete-li zahrnout databázovou tabulku pro vytvoření zobrazení atributů, klikněte na uzel datové základny a postupujte podle pokynů krok za krokem, jak je uvedeno níže -
- Přetáhněte tabulku „PRODUCT“ a „PRODUCT_DESC“ z uzlu TABLE pod DHK_SCHEMA
- Přetáhněte „PRODUCT“ a „PRODUCT_DESC“ do datového základního uzlu.
- Vyberte pole z tabulky „PRODUKT“ jako výstup v podokně podrobností. Barva ikony pole se změní ze šedé na oranžovou.
- Vyberte pole z tabulky „PRODUCT_DESC“ jako Výstup v podokně podrobností. Změna barvy ikony pole ze šedé na oranžovou.
- Pole vybrané jako výstup z obou tabulek se zobrazí pod seznamem sloupců v podokně výstupu.
Připojte se k tabulce „PRODUCT“ do pole „PRODUCT_DESC“ podle pole „PRODUCT_ID“.
KROK 5) Vyberte možnost Připojit cestu a klikněte na ni pravým tlačítkem myši a vyberte možnost Upravit. Zobrazí se obrazovka Upravit podmínku připojení
- Vyberte Typ spojení jako Typ „Vnitřní“.
- Vyberte mohutnost jako „1… 1“.
Po výběru typu připojení klikněte na tlačítko „OK“. V dalším kroku vybereme sloupec a definujeme klíč pro výstup.
KROK 6) V tomto kroku vybereme sloupec a definujeme klíč pro výstup
- Vyberte sémantický panel.
- V podokně podrobností se zobrazí karta Sloupec.
- Jako klíč vyberte „PRODUCT_ID“.
- Zaškrtněte možnost Skryté pro pole PRODUCT_ID_1 (pole tabulky PRODUCT_DESC).
- Klikněte na tlačítko Ověřit.
- Po úspěšném ověření klikněte na tlačítko Aktivovat.
Protokol úlohy pro ověření a aktivaci se zobrazuje v dolní části obrazovky na stejné stránce, tj. V části Protokol úlohy, jak je uvedeno níže -
KROK 7) Bude vytvořeno zobrazení atributu s názvem „AT_PRODUCT“. Chcete-li zobrazit, obnovte složku Zobrazení atributů.
- Přejděte na balíček DHK_SCHEMA-> MODELING.
- AT_PRODUCT Zobrazení zobrazení atributů ve složce Zobrazení atributů.
KROK 8) Chcete-li zobrazit data v zobrazení atributů,
- Na panelu nástrojů vyberte možnost Náhled dat.
- Pro zobrazení dat z pohledu atributů budou dvě možnosti -
- Otevřít v editoru náhledu dat (Zobrazí data s možností analýzy).
- Otevřít v editoru SQL. (Zobrazí se výstup pouze jako Výstup dotazu SQL).
KROK 9) Chcete-li zobrazit Zobrazit data atributů v editoru náhledu dat -
K dispozici jsou 3 možnosti - analýza, odlišná a nezpracovaná data
Analýza : Toto je grafické znázornění pohledu atributů.
- Výběrem karty Analýza vybereme Atributy pro zobrazení formátu Štítek a Osa.
- Atribut přetažení v ose štítku se zobrazí v ose štítku (osa X).
- Atribut drag and drop v hodnotové ose se zobrazí v hodnotové ose (osa Y).
- Výstup bude k dispozici ve formátu Chart, Table, Grid a HTML.
Výrazné hodnoty : Zde lze zobrazit zřetelnou hodnotu sloupce. Zobrazí se celkové číslo. záznamy pro vybraný atribut.
Karta Nezpracovaná data: Tato možnost zobrazí data zobrazení atributů ve formátu tabulky.
- Klikněte na kartu Nezpracovaná data
- Zobrazí data ve formátu tabulky
KROK 10) Zobrazit data atributů v editoru SQL, jak je uvedeno níže -
Tato možnost zobrazí data prostřednictvím dotazu SQL ze zobrazení sloupce ve schématu „SYS_BIC“. Po aktivaci zobrazení atributu „AT_PRODUCT“ bude vytvořeno zobrazení sloupce ". Toto se používá k zobrazení dotazu SQL použitého pro zobrazení dat z pohledu.
- Zobrazit dotaz SQL pro výběr dat.
- Výstup displeje.
Pokud je aktivováno zobrazení atributu, vytvoří se zobrazení sloupce ve schématu _SYS_BIC. Když tedy spustíme náhled dat, systém vybere data ze zobrazení sloupce pod schématem _SYS_BIC.
Snímek obrazovky zobrazení sloupce „AT_PRODUCT“ pod „_SYS_BIC“ Schéma uzlu katalogu je uvedeno níže -